What will you be doing?

The successful candidate will provide administrative support within the Service, the community centre, and in conjunction with the PROACT SCIPr UK Team. Your hours will be approximately 20 hours for Larkfield each week and 10 hours for the PROACT SCIPr UK Team.

You will contribute to the effective running of the office, setting up and maintaining systems and processes, taking minutes of meetings, and sharing information with colleagues as required.

You will support and liaise with customers on behalf of the service, in relation to service delivery or financial expenditures.

You will be based at Larkfield in Ely for the majority of the week; however, you will need to be able to travel within the county to support the PROACT SCIPr UK Team.

You will be required to take bookings and maintain records for the Community Centre and the PROACT SCIPr UK Team, ensuring that we maximise the use of the building.

About you

You will require grade A -C GCSE in English and Maths.

You will have a good working knowledge of IT systems and applications, particularly Microsoft apps such as Word, Excel, Outlook, Publisher, and Teams.

You will need to be able to plan and organise your workload effectively, managing your own priorities while supporting your colleagues and the SCIP Team.

You will need the ability to work in a challenging, demanding and rewarding environment.
